On Tue, Sep 14, 2021 at 02:26:27PM +0800, Fei Li wrote:
> +struct acrn_vdev {
> +	/*
> +	 * the identifier of the device, the low 32 bits represent the vendor
> +	 * id and device id of PCI device and the high 32 bits represent the
> +	 * device number of the legacy device
> +	 */
> +	union {
> +		__u64 value;
> +		struct {
> +			__u16 vendor;
> +			__u16 device;
> +			__u32 legacy_id;

What is the endian of these fields?

Please always specify them.
